Discover the early years of Thomas Merton's journey as a monk and writer in this insightful volume of his journals, filled with reflections on silence, community, and creativity.

This second volume of Merton's journals covers his first experiences of monastic life at the Abbey of Gethsemani - silence, chanting, farm work, the politics of life within a community of monks - and the productive early years of his writing career.
